开源项目 a-font-garde 使用教程
1. 项目的目录结构及介绍
a-font-garde/
├── fonts/
├── lib/
├── src/
├── .gitignore
├── .jshintrc
├── Gruntfile.js
├── LICENSE
├── README-image.md
├── README.md
├── afontgarde.css
├── afontgarde.js
├── docs/
│ └── css/
├── markup-image.html
├── markup-tests.html
├── markup.html
├── package.json
- fonts/: 存放字体文件的目录。
- lib/: 存放项目依赖的库文件。
- src/: 存放源代码文件。
- .gitignore: Git 忽略配置文件。
- .jshintrc: JavaScript 代码风格检查配置文件。
- Gruntfile.js: Grunt 任务配置文件。
- LICENSE: 项目许可证文件。
- README-image.md: 包含图片的 README 文件。
- README.md: 项目说明文件。
- afontgarde.css: 项目样式文件。
- afontgarde.js: 项目脚本文件。
- docs/: 存放文档文件的目录。
- markup-image.html: 标记图像的 HTML 文件。
- markup-tests.html: 标记测试的 HTML 文件。
- markup.html: 标记的 HTML 文件。
- package.json: Node.js 项目配置文件。
2. 项目的启动文件介绍
项目的启动文件主要是 Gruntfile.js
和 package.json
。
- Gruntfile.js: 该文件定义了项目的构建任务,包括代码检查、测试和打包等。
- package.json: 该文件包含了项目的元数据,如名称、版本、依赖等。通过运行
npm install
可以安装项目所需的所有依赖。
3. 项目的配置文件介绍
- .jshintrc: 该文件用于配置 JSHint,一个 JavaScript 代码质量工具。
- Gruntfile.js: 除了作为启动文件外,也包含了项目的构建配置。
- package.json: 包含了项目的依赖配置和其他元数据。
通过以上介绍,您可以更好地理解和使用 a-font-garde
项目。希望这份文档对您有所帮助!